Four days of faith, Romagnola tradition, and celebration between Poggio Berni and Camerano
The Parish Community Festival of Poggio Berni and Camerano is one of the most cherished events in the summer calendar for the hamlets of the Municipality of Poggio Torriana, in the Province of Rimini, in the heart of Valmarecchia. Born from the union of the historic Marian celebrations of the two hamlets โ the Festival of Our Lady of the Rosary in Poggio Berni and the Festival of Our Lady of Camerano โ the event brings together the inhabitants of the two villages every June in one grand community celebration.
The heart of the festival remains deeply religious. The opening evening features the Holy Mass in the Church of Sant'Andrea Apostolo in Poggio Berni, followed by the evocative torchlight procession that accompanies the image of Our Lady of the Rosary to the Church of Santa Maria Annunziata in Camerano. In the following days, the Holy Rosary, solemn masses animated by choirs and tenors, and on Sunday, the celebration presided over by the Bishop with the feast of wedding anniversaries for the community's couples, take place.
Alongside the spiritual dimension, the festival offers all the warmth of Romagnola hospitality. Every evening, the food stalls offer traditional dishes: from tripe to Romagnola specialties, from filled piadine to hamburgers, to spaghetti and the ring cake offered to participants. There are also charity raffles, live music with dance orchestras and bands, and entertainment dedicated to children, young people, and families, as well as an exhibition of works created by artists from the parish community, open for the entire duration of the event.
Poggio Torriana, born in 2014 from the merger of Poggio Berni and Torriana, is a small hilly municipality overlooking the Marecchia river valley, a few kilometers from the Rimini coast. Participating in this festival means discovering the most authentic Romagna, that of the villages, the parishes, and the village festivals that have marked the rhythm of the community for generations.
The 2026 edition confirms the traditional format: the festival opens on Thursday, June 11th, with Holy Mass and the torchlight procession of Our Lady of the Rosary, continues with the Family Festival on Friday in Camerano, and culminates on Sunday with the solemn mass presided over by the Bishop and the celebration of wedding anniversaries. Every evening, food stalls with Romagnola specialties, charity raffles, and live music and entertainment.
An exhibition of works by artists from the parish community is open for the entire duration of the festival.
The festival takes place between the hamlets of Poggio Berni and Camerano, in the Municipality of Poggio Torriana (RN), in Valmarecchia. The main events are held at the Church of Santa Maria Annunziata in Camerano and the Church of Sant'Andrea Apostolo in Poggio Berni.
By car from the A14 motorway, exit at Rimini Nord, then take the SS9 and SP258 Marecchiese towards Valmarecchia. Poggio Torriana is about 20 km from Rimini. A shuttle service between the festival points is often provided.
Admission to the festival and religious celebrations is free. Food stalls and charity raffles are paid.
